Key fobs Many newer vehicles come with key fobs that are similar to car remotes but more portable. These devices are equipped with a small radio transmitter which transmits a specific signal coded to the receiver within the vehicle. When you press the button on the key fob, the transmitter communicates with the receiver in order to open the vehicle door or to start the motor. While these devices are handy and offer additional security, they can be vulnerable to hacking. For instance, a person with a budget of $50 can utilize a device dubbed relay attack to block the signal that goes between the key fob and the car. Transponders Transponders are an essential component of key fobs and other security devices for vehicles. They transmit low-frequency signals to a device situated in the ignition. The vehicle will start when the signal matches the code that is programmed into the car's system. They can also be found in remote controls for garage doors, gates and homes. Contrary to traditional mechanical keys remote control keys can be programmed to open and close a door or gate with a single button press. They are a hit because they are more secure and convenient than standard keys. Newer cars use transponder technology to stop theft and start the engine when the key is inserted or pulled. These chips can be built into your key fob or they can be a separate transponder that is inserted into the slot in your ignition. The circuitry of your car detects the code transmitted by the transponder, and then transmits a signal to the computer that the key has been being inserted. This process takes a few milliseconds, isn't noticeable, but it's essential for the car to start. Some cars can be programmed in just a few minutes by using the onboard procedure, or by connecting an OBD2 port. Certain cars require more complicated programming procedures like EEPROM. The EEPROM program is the most complicated method of programming keys for cars and requires the removal of specific modules from your car in order to read the key information stored on them.
